Steven Arcangeli
0cff2447b5
WIP: properly escape paths in Windows
...
Still not working with $ (try a file named a$PATH.txt).
:edit a$PATH.txt will expand the variable
:edit a\$PATH.txt will treat it as a path separator, so a/$PATH.txt
2023-11-04 08:43:03 -07:00
Steven Arcangeli
ee813638d2
feat: make gf work in ssh files ( #186 )
2023-09-30 14:20:28 -07:00
Steven Arcangeli
7aeb239a6a
refactor: rename supports_xfer
2023-08-20 21:50:02 +00:00
Steven Arcangeli
8f7807946a
fix: remaining type errors
2023-08-13 13:32:35 -07:00
Steven Arcangeli
47c7737618
fix: type annotations and type errors
2023-08-12 20:32:52 -07:00
Steven Arcangeli
a5ff72a8da
fix: url-escape paths for scp ( #134 )
2023-06-30 00:59:08 -07:00
Steven Arcangeli
4a4e0f4013
refactor: small perf win by eliminating string object keys
2023-06-25 22:44:44 -07:00
Andrew Cohen
53dcf6ee49
Escape dollar sign
2023-06-20 11:25:30 -04:00
Steven Arcangeli
6f8bf067c0
fix: stop using vim.wo to set window options
...
vim.wo also affects the global status of the option. We only want to set
the window-local option.
2023-06-16 18:24:47 -07:00
Steven Arcangeli
d27bfa1f37
refactor: use more modern methods for getting/setting options
2023-05-21 20:40:09 -07:00
Steven Arcangeli
339ade9dc3
fix: escape special characters when editing buffer ( #96 )
2023-05-05 08:32:44 -07:00
Steven Arcangeli
273c2cecbf
feat: can cancel out of progress window
2023-03-29 18:43:56 -07:00
Steven Arcangeli
080dd27474
refactor: clean up duplicate helper method
2023-03-29 18:42:48 -07:00
Steven Arcangeli
b36ba91b7a
fix: another case of incorrect alternate buffers ( #60 )
2023-03-06 00:14:06 -08:00
Steven Arcangeli
2e95b9d424
fix: edge case where opening a file would delete its contents
2023-02-03 13:53:01 -08:00
Steven Arcangeli
716dd8f9cf
fix: unexpected behavior from BufReadPost autocmds
2023-01-28 18:07:18 -08:00
Steven Arcangeli
6c6b7673af
feat: update preview window when cursor is moved ( #42 )
2023-01-21 18:46:30 -08:00
Steven Arcangeli
4e853eabcb
fix: alternate buffer preservation ( #43 )
2023-01-20 02:56:57 -08:00
Steven Arcangeli
a60639db35
fix: no error if opening file that has swapfile
2023-01-20 02:23:57 -08:00
Steven Arcangeli
a6884431b0
fix: error when editing a dir, and still missing parent window ( #40 )
2023-01-19 20:44:01 -08:00
Steven Arcangeli
ca4da68aae
feat: builtin support for editing files over ssh ( #27 )
2023-01-18 10:25:22 -08:00
Steven Arcangeli
b4ccc16944
fix: renaming buffers doesn't interfere with directory hijack ( #25 )
2023-01-10 22:33:15 -08:00
Steven Arcangeli
9f7c4d74e1
feat: display shortened path as title of floating window ( #12 )
2023-01-04 01:30:33 -08:00
Steven Arcangeli
fefd6ad5e4
feat: first draft
2023-01-02 01:34:53 -08:00